Comment Accreditation
•Following successful completion you will receive a QQI Level 5 component Certificate in School Age Childcare (5N1781).

•QQI (Quality & Qualifications Ireland) is the national awarding body for further education and training in Ireland. The Open College is registered with QQI to offer programmes leading to QQI awards in the National Framework of Qualifications in Ireland.

Number of Credits NFQ Credit Value: 15 credits.
Careers or Further Progression Progression to further Studies:

•This course leads to a level 5 award on the National Framework of Qualifications. Learners can use this credit towards completing the major award in Early Childhood Care and Education – 5M2009.
